Subject: [PATCH 3.16 148/294] r8169: Do not increment tx_dropped in TX
 ring cleaning

3.16.50-rc1 review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

------------------

From: Florian Fainelli <f.fainelli@...il.com>

commit 1089650d8837095f63e001bbf14d7b48043d67ad upstream.

rtl8169_tx_clear_range() is responsible for cleaning up the TX ring
during interface shutdown, incrementing tx_dropped for every SKB that we
left at the time in the ring is misleading.
